- Some Novel Phosphoranides containing Pentafluorophenyl Groups
-
Several novel phosphoranides containing pentafluorophenyl groups, of formulae - (X= Cl, Y= Cl, Br, or I; X= Br, Y= Br or I; X= NCS, Y= Cl, Br, I or NCS) or - (X= Cl, Y= Cl, Br, or I; X= Br, Y= Br or I; X= CN, Y= Cl, Br, I, or NCS) have been identified in solution by means of 31P n.m.r. spectroscopy.Most of the species have been isolated as salts with tetra-alkylammonium ions, and further characterised by elemental analysis and (in some cases) i.r. spectroscopy.These ions -> represent the first simple phosphoranides with an organo-group attached to phosphorus and no cyano-groups present.The species with two pentafluorophenyl groups are the first phosphoranides with two organo-groups directly bound to phosphorus.No acceptor properties towards halide ions were shown by P(CCl3)Cl2 or P(C6F5)2(NCS).
